Space Environment Training

Military training for space operations incorporates specialized instruction known as space environment training, which prepares personnel to operate effectively in the unique conditions of outer space. This type of training includes understanding microgravity, radiation exposure, and the vacuum of space, all of which significantly differ from Earth’s environment.

Participants engage in simulated scenarios that replicate the challenges of executing missions in a space-like atmosphere. For instance, astronauts and military personnel practice maneuvers in drop towers or use parabolic flight paths to experience short-duration weightlessness. This hands-on experience cultivates critical skills necessary for successful space operations.

Additionally, training facilities often utilize advanced technologies, such as vacuum chambers and controlled environments, to familiarize trainees with the physiological effects of space travel, including muscle atrophy and fluid redistribution. Challenges in Military Training for Space Operations

Military training for space operations presents multifaceted challenges that require strategic consideration. One significant hurdle is the complexity and rapid evolution of technology. As advancements occur in space systems, training frameworks must adapt to incorporate new equipment and methodologies, which may outpace current training capabilities.

Another challenge lies in the multidisciplinary nature of space operations. Personnel must be adept in fields such as astronomy, engineering, and computer science, necessitating comprehensive education and training programs. This complexity can lead to resource constraints, as intersecting specialties demand extensive curricula and varied expertise.

The logistical issues of conducting training exercises in space environments further complicate military operations. Issues such as access to simulated outer space settings and the high costs associated with such training can restrict the frequency and effectiveness of preparedness drills. These logistical challenges highlight the importance of developing innovative solutions for military training for space operations to ensure operational readiness.

Lastly, international collaboration poses both opportunities and difficulties. Aligning training standards and practices among various countries can be intricate, often resulting in discrepancies that affect joint operations. Effective coordination and communication are essential to overcoming these challenges and maximizing the benefits of collaborative military training initiatives.
